Can cats have their beards cut? It is not recommended to cut cats' beards as they will keep them neat. If you have a special reason, it is recommended to consult a veterinarian first to ensure the health of your cat.
The cat's beard is very important for cats. The main function is to measure distance. The cat uses the beard to determine whether the width can be guaranteed to pass by itself and avoid being stuck.
Moreover, cats have thicker beards than ordinary hair, and the roots of the beards penetrate deep into the skin and are densely covered with nerve endings, so the beards have the function of tactile receptors. Cats can use their beards to help detect changes in airflow, allowing them to avoid obstacles in the dark.
Therefore, cats must not be cut. If the cat's beard is cut off, the cat will lose its ability to hunt. Without a beard, they will not be able to distinguish the direction and cannot keep running quickly. And they will become timid and nervous.
